There are many forces at work threatening to change the very nature of the accounting profession .Technology is evolving at an exponential rate, changing or eliminating traditional clerical and decision making accounting processes . This and exploding globalism are altering drastically the commercial landscape, and the values that organizations place on traditional and emerging assets.
